Clear All Filters
White Regular Fit Long Sleeve Oxford Shirt
£26
Navy Blue Jersey Twill Popper Shacket
£42
Charcoal Grey Slim Fit Long Sleeve Oxford Shirt
Denim Blue Regular Fit Button Down Easy Iron Oxford Shirt
£24
White Slim Fit Long Sleeve Oxford Shirt
Light Blue Slim Fit Long Sleeve Oxford Shirt
Charcoal Grey Stretch Oxford Long Sleeve Shirt
£30
White Stretch Oxford Long Sleeve Shirt
Grey Marl Regular Fit Button Down Easy Iron Oxford Shirt
Navy Blue Stretch Oxford Long Sleeve Shirt